Irene Hargis Obituary

Helen Irene Hargis, age 80 of Groveland, Florida passed away Tuesday, September 30, 2025. She joins the love of her life, Charles “Chuck” Hargis in God’s heavenly kingdom. Irene (as she preferred) was born on December 28, 1944 in Belleville, Illinois to the late Helen and Charles Purdy. She married Chuck Hargis on August 22, 1964 in Belleville, Illinois and had their only child, Bruce L. Hargis on April 16, 1967. Her world revolved around Bruce…until he had kids.

‍Irene held many titles in her life, wife, mother, daughter, sister, aunt, daughter-in-law, sister-in-law, God-Mother, mother-in-law (She hated that one.), friend, paralegal, but Grandma and Great-Grandma had them ALL beat. My, how she loved the babies! It would not be unusual for her to sit and do puzzles, color or play catch on the living room floor. During the holidays her family could not wait until she made her famous pies and later she was seen teaching her great-grand kids the secrets to her special recipes.

Irene was always a hard worker. For many years she worked as a paralegal for various law firms and even for the U.S. Air Force. She won many accommodations and awards in her professional career. Her career followed her when she and Chuck moved to Florida to follow Bruce and his wife Yvonne and the grandkids.

‍Irene was an avid St. Louis Cardinals Fan, insisting on watching every game she could on the MLB channel and later in life after recovering from a broken ankle she picked up coloring in adult coloring books. Her family marveled at her masterpieces.

She is survived by her son, Bruce Hargis and wife Yvonne (Johnson) Hargis; grandchildren Aaron Hargis, Amanda Hargis Webb (Timothy Webb) and McKenna Hargis, Great-grandchildren; Paige Hargis, Aadyn Hargis, Zoey Hargis, Thomas Webb, Aaron Jones and Jozalyn Sullivan. Sisters Rosemary Yaekel (Jim Yaekel) and JoAnn Elmore and her brother Charles “Charlie” Purdy (Juanita Purdy). She is also survived by her sisters-in-law Barbara Bretz (Karl Bretz), Miriam Poston (Ken Poston) and Lorna VonTalge (Ron VonTalge), and brother-in-law Olen Lawrence Hargis (Nancy Hargis). She is preceded in death by her sisters-in-law Joan Ferris and Sarah Thompson and brother-in-law Wayne Elmore. She also leaves many cousins, nieces, nephews and God-children whom she treasured.

‍A celebration of Irene’s life will be conducted at 2:00 p.m. EST, Sunday, October 26, 2025 at Woodlands Lutheran Church, 15333 County Road 455, Montverde, Florida. The service may be attended virtually by livestreaming at: https://youtube.com/live/VVp-hSY84r8. There will be a reception immediately following in the social hall for friends and family to gather. We ask all in attendance wear her favorite color, purple if possible.
